On Sat, Jun 03, 2006 at 04:57:56PM +0530, Anand Gupta wrote:>    On the stable version i used the following to compile a custom kernel
 >
 >    make linux-2.6-xen-config CONFIGMODE=menuconfig
 >
 >    However the above returns the following error:
 >
 >    make -f buildconfigs/mk.linux-2.6-xen config
 >    make[1]: Entering directory `/root/xen/xen-
unstable.hg'
 >    make -C linux-2.6.16.13-xen ARCH=x86_64 menuconfig
 >    make[2]: Entering directory
 >    `/root/xen/xen-unstable.hg/linux-2.6.16.13-xen'
 >      HOSTCC  scripts/kconfig/lxdialog/checklist.o
 >    In file included from scripts/kconfig/lxdialog/checklist.c:24:
 >    scripts/kconfig/lxdialog/dialog.h:31:20: curses.h: No such file or
 >    directory
 
 You're missing the ncurses development files.
 
 If you're running debian you can fix this by running:
 
 apt-get install libncurses5-dev
 
 If you're running some other distribution then you should install the
 package using its mechanism.
